diff --git a/include/matador/utils/access.hpp b/include/matador/utils/access.hpp index 7356dfc..707ef77 100644 --- a/include/matador/utils/access.hpp +++ b/include/matador/utils/access.hpp @@ -78,22 +78,22 @@ void belongs_to(Operator &op, const char *id, Type &value) { } template class ContainerType> -void has_many(Operator &op, const char *id, container &c, const char *join_column, const utils::foreign_attributes &attr) { +void has_many(Operator &op, const char *id, ContainerType &c, const char *join_column, const utils::foreign_attributes &attr) { op.on_has_many(id, c, join_column, attr); } template class ContainerType> -void has_many(Operator &op, const char *id, container &c, const char *join_column) { +void has_many(Operator &op, const char *id, ContainerType &c, const char *join_column) { op.on_has_many(id, c, join_column); } template class ContainerType> -void has_many(Operator &op, const char *id, container &c, const utils::foreign_attributes &attr) { +void has_many(Operator &op, const char *id, ContainerType &c, const utils::foreign_attributes &attr) { op.on_has_many(id, c, attr); } template class ContainerType> -void has_many(Operator &op, const char *id, container &c) { +void has_many(Operator &op, const char *id, ContainerType &c) { op.on_has_many(id, c); }